Output 34f04dd343be65baea0b5fe2c22c81332818328fde3a3e8d6e4e2d7be5b9fbd6:1

value
22020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2132120c12e62f28bdca55fc0eb932f9be95b119 OP_EQUAL
address
34iYCqHLr6EBwcmPi4gUU9qALhPK7zj2nP
transaction
34f04dd343be65baea0b5fe2c22c81332818328fde3a3e8d6e4e2d7be5b9fbd6
confirmations
312906
spent
true